With a small memory footprint, Lounge Lizard EP-4 would be great for live use in addition to studio use. There are over 100 custom electric piano presets that offer a great starting point, but the real-time controls (hammer hardness, color, decay, damper noise, pickup placement) are always there waiting for you if you want to customize. Lounge Lizard EP-4 will appeal to sound designers and preset lovers alike.
